Sugar-free watermelon popsicles with lemon
Prep time: 15 mins | Waiting time: 4-5 hours | Total time: 15 mins | Serves: 6
Ingredients
for 6 popsicles
- 800 g watermelon (net weight, measured without rind or seeds)
- juice of 1 lemon
- 1-2 tbsp honey or agave syrup (depending on the sweetness of the watermelon)
- a few fresh mint leaves
Directions
- For the watermelon, lemon and mint popsicles, cut the prepared watermelon into pieces and blend along with the lemon juice, mint leaves and your sweetener of choice until smooth.
- Taste and add more sweetener if required.
- Pour the mixture into the popsicle moulds, insert the sticks and place them in the freezer for 4–5 hours, or overnight, until completely frozen.
- To unmould, briefly run under warm water.
